2025 Compare Cities Politics & Voting:
Okemos, MI vs Cedar Rapids, IA
Change Cities
Highlights
- Registered voters in Cedar Rapids are 15.9% less likely to be registered as Democrats than registered voters in Okemos.
- Registered voters in Okemos, are 19.8% more likely to be registered as Democrats, than in the rest of the United States.
